使用VPN后无法打开网页?常见原因及解决方法全解析
作为一名网络工程师,我经常遇到用户反馈:“我用了VPN,但打不开网页了!”这个问题看似简单,实则背后可能涉及多个层面的网络配置、安全策略或服务异常,本文将从技术角度出发,详细分析可能导致该问题的原因,并提供实用的排查与解决方案。
我们要明确一个关键点:使用VPN并不等于“直接访问互联网”,VPN(虚拟私人网络)的本质是通过加密隧道将你的设备连接到远程服务器,从而实现流量转发和地址伪装,如果你在使用过程中无法加载网页,问题很可能出在以下几个环节:
-
DNS解析失败
很多用户在启用VPN后,默认DNS会被替换为VPN服务商提供的服务器,如果这些DNS服务器不稳定或被防火墙屏蔽,就会导致域名无法解析,你输入百度.com,系统找不到对应的IP地址,自然无法打开网页。
✅ 解决方案:尝试手动更换DNS为公共DNS,如Google的8.8.8.8或Cloudflare的1.1.1.1,进入系统网络设置,修改DNS配置即可。 -
路由表冲突或错误
某些VPN客户端会自动修改系统的路由表,将所有流量引导至VPN通道,如果目标网站不在该通道内(比如某些本地化服务),或者路由规则配置错误,会导致请求无法正确发出。
✅ 解决方案:运行命令route print(Windows)或ip route show(Linux/macOS)查看当前路由表,确认是否有异常条目,可尝试断开VPN后重新连接,或选择“仅代理特定流量”的模式(Split Tunneling)。 -
防火墙或杀毒软件拦截
部分企业级防火墙或杀毒软件会识别并阻止非标准的VPN流量,尤其是当检测到大量异常端口通信时,这会导致连接中断或超时。
✅ 解决方案:临时关闭防火墙或杀毒软件测试是否恢复正常;若有效,应添加白名单规则,允许该VPN应用通过。 -
VPN服务器本身故障或限速
如果你使用的是一家免费或质量较低的VPN服务,其服务器可能负载过高、带宽受限,甚至被运营商限流,此时即便连接成功,也无法正常浏览网页。
✅ 解决方案:切换至其他节点或更换更可靠的付费服务;可用工具如ping、traceroute测试延迟和丢包率。 -
浏览器缓存或代理设置残留
有些用户在使用过代理工具后未清除设置,导致浏览器仍试图通过旧代理访问网络,即使断开了VPN,也可能继续尝试走代理路径。
✅ 解决方案:检查浏览器代理设置(如Chrome的“设置 > 系统 > 打开代理设置”),确保为“不使用代理”。
最后提醒一点:不要盲目信任所有VPN服务,尤其在使用国内网络环境时,部分境外服务可能存在合规性风险,建议优先选择有备案资质的服务商。
当你发现“用了VPN打不开网页”,不要急着换工具,先冷静排查以上五大常见因素,掌握这些基础排错逻辑,不仅能快速解决问题,还能提升你对网络协议的理解——这才是网络工程师的核心能力!

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速











